William Sawalich goes wire-to-wire in ARCA Series at Salem Speedway

SALEM, Ind. — For the third consecutive year at Salem Speedway, the driver who visited Victory Lane led every lap from the pole.

William Sawalich put together a dominant performance reminiscent of Jesse Love and Sammy Smith Saturday night on his way to his fourth victory of the 2024 ARCA Menards Series season. He survived multiple restarts throughout the night and no one in the field could touch the No. 18 Joe Gibbs Racing Toyota.

Sawalich was thrilled to enjoy a relatively stress-free evening at a unique, fast facility like Salem, but made sure to extend credit for his wire-to-wire victory to everyone that helped prepare his No. 18 Starkey/SoundGear Toyota.

“My Joe Gibbs Racing team really brought me a fast Toyota Camry tonight,” Sawalich said. “I can’t thank them enough for all their hard work. We had a really, really good car tonight. Honestly, there aren’t too many complaints from me.

“It’s really easy for me as a driver on nights like this.”

Victories have been slightly more difficult for Sawalich to accumulate in 2024 compared to his efficient rookie year that saw him claim the ARCA Menards Series East title.

Sawalich has spent the year building a rivalry with fellow young prospect Connor Zilisch. The two have come together on several occasions, with Sawalich himself being forced to watch Zilisch take checkered flags at Dover Motor Speedway, Iowa Speedway and Lucas Oil Indianapolis Raceway Park.

Although he has enjoyed plenty of stellar races already this year, Sawalich arrived at Salem Speedway determined to show the rest of the field he and Gibbs were not to be trifled with.

Winning the pole by more than two-tenths on his first lap set a commanding tone that carried over into the Salem ARCA 200. Sawalich effortlessly gapped the field on each restart and could barely make out Andres Perez in his rearview mirror by the time the checkered flag waved.

The last time Sawalich enjoyed a perfect race was his maiden victory on the East Series platform in 2023 at Five Flags Speedway. Sawalich formally introduced himself to the ARCA platform that evening by dominating from the pole, with that victory serving as the first major step towards the East Series title.

Sawalich currently finds himself with a small deficit to Zilisch in his quest to defend his East Series crown. With another wire-to-wire showing on his resume, Sawalich has plenty of momentum and time to usurp Zilisch in the East Series and rack up more trophies across all three ARCA divisions.

Following Perez in third was his Rev Racing teammate Lavar Scott. Will Kimmel emerged victorious in a heated three-car battle for fourth, where he was followed in the running order by Christian Rose.

The attrition that plagued the Salem ARCA 200 allowed many small teams to enjoy strong nights. Making up the rest of the top 10 were Isaac Johnson, Cody Dennison, Ryan Roulette, Brayton Laster and Kris Wright.
